Why Take the 1 Month Vegan Challenge?
Going vegan for a month is more than a dietary experiment—it’s an educational and often transformative experience. Here are a few compelling reasons why many choose to take the leap:
1. Health Benefits
A well-planned vegan diet can provide all the nutrients your body needs and has been linked to lower risks of heart disease, hypertension, type 2 diabetes, and certain cancers. Many participants report increased energy, improved digestion, better skin, and even weight loss within just a few weeks.
2. Environmental Impact
Animal agriculture is one of the largest contributors to greenhouse gas emissions, deforestation, and water consumption. By switching to a plant-based diet for even one month, participants significantly reduce their carbon footprint and water usage.
3. Compassion and Ethics
For those concerned with animal welfare, the vegan challenge is a way to align their daily choices with their values. It provides an opportunity to live more consciously, reducing harm to animals and promoting a more compassionate lifestyle.
4. Culinary Exploration
Far from being restrictive, veganism opens up a world of vibrant, flavorful, and nourishing meals. From Indian curries to Mediterranean bowls and Asian stir-fries, the challenge encourages culinary creativity.

What to Look for in a Vegan Challenge E-book
Not all e-books are created equal. When choosing one for your 1 Month Vegan Challenge, consider the following features:
-
Clear Meal Plans: Look for e-books that offer a full 30-day plan with breakfast, lunch, dinner, and snacks.
-
Nutritional Guidance: Ensure the book covers important nutrients like B12, iron, protein, calcium, and omega-3s.
-
Ingredient Substitutes: A good e-book helps you swap ingredients you may not have or don’t like.
-
Allergen-Friendly Options: If you have allergies or sensitivities (e.g., gluten, soy, nuts), check for inclusive recipes.
-
Beautiful Design: High-quality photos, easy-to-read formatting, and helpful tips go a long way in making the experience enjoyable.
Tips for a Successful Vegan Month
Embarking on a new lifestyle can be challenging. Here are a few practical tips to make your 1-month challenge a success:
-
Start Simple: Begin with meals you already enjoy and know how to make—just veganize them.
-
Plan Ahead: Meal prepping and planning your week can prevent last-minute stress or hunger-driven decisions.
-
Explore New Foods: Try new vegetables, grains, and plant-based proteins like tofu, tempeh, lentils, and chickpeas.
-
Join a Community: Online forums, social media groups, or vegan challenge hashtags can provide support and accountability.
-
Be Gentle With Yourself: If you slip up, don't give up. Every plant-based meal makes a difference.
